From 36447456e1cca853188505f2a964dbbeacfc7a7a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Mike Rapoport Date: Wed, 17 Jan 2018 20:27:11 +0200 Subject: ima/policy: fix parsing of fsuuid The switch to uuid_t invereted the logic of verfication that &entry->fsuuid is zero during parsing of "fsuuid=" rule. Instead of making sure the &entry->fsuuid field is not attempted to be overwritten, we bail out for perfectly correct rule.
